Saudi Arabia has lifted the ban on poultry products imported from Pakistan, according to the Khaleej Times.

The country initially banned chicken meat and eggs from Pakistan due to growing concerns of avian influenza spreading, but resumed trade after the WHO declared Pakistan free from AI.

Pakistani poultry farmers welcomed the news along with projections that the country's poultry industry should grow considerably in the future.
